Palmdale, CA (January 1, 2025) – Emergency responders were dispatched to the scene of a traffic collision with injuries on 30th St W, just south of Columbia Way, on Tuesday evening. The incident occurred in the northbound lanes and involved two vehicles, one with significant front-end damage and the other with major rear-end damage.
The California Highway Patrol (CHP) managed the scene, coordinating with towing services to remove the damaged vehicles. Units arrived at the site shortly after the crash was reported, working to clear the roadways and provide assistance to those involved. Emergency responders assessed individuals for injuries, and further medical attention was likely provided to those requiring additional care.
Authorities are investigating the collision to determine the contributing factors, and additional updates may be released as the investigation progresses.
